‘Redefining Beauty Discovery and Commerce’ Event with TikTok Shop

Social commerce is booming, in just four years TikTok Shop has become the UK’s -largest online beauty retailer, with more than 30,000 brands now second active on the UK platform, and one beauty product sold every second. The British Beauty Council partnered with TikTok Shop for an in-depth exploration of the platform’s transformative impact on beauty retail and the scale of the opportunity.

How will beauty and wellness develop in 2026?

Here, experts from Circana share their predictions in this space using data driven insights…
LED masks and Oura rings are becoming as commonplace in beauty routines as hyaluronic acids, cream cleansers and lip balms. According to Circana, the facial devices and tools category grew by +59.1% last year and 68% of consumers use a watch, ring, or wristband to monitor their health.
Your Guide to Trading In or Exporting to South Korea

South Korea holds a unique space in the cosmetics and skincare world. Following the rise of “K-beauty”, it has become one of the most influential countries in the beauty industry. The country also has a strong appetite for British brands and many big players, such as Lush, are already well-established in the Korean market.

Misinformation a growing concern in young people according to new Curriculum Assessment Review

Earlier this month, the Department for Education published its Curriculum Assessment Review (CAR), calling for better education on misinformation, as well as climate and sustainability in the face of changing digital trends and prevalence of Artificial Intelligence (AI).
